Understanding Mobility ScootersWhat Are Mobility Scooters?
Mobility scooters are 3 or four-wheeled personal transportation devices designed for those who have trouble walking fars away due to age, disability, or health conditions. They can be used for a range of activities, ranging from shopping to socialising, and can differ significantly in style, size, and performance.
Types of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ters can be broadly categorized into numerous types:
Type of ScooterDescriptionBest ForClass 2 ScootersDesigned for usage on walkways and pedestrian areas, these scooters have a maximum speed of 4mph.Short journeys and shopping trips.Class 3 ScootersEfficient in speeds up to 8mph, these scooters can be utilized on roadways however must stick to traffic policies.Longer journeys and outdoor usage.Portable/Travel ScootersLight-weight and collapsible, these scooters are developed for simple transport and storage.Taking a trip, vacations, and public transport.Durable ScootersBuilt for stability and strength, these scooters can support much heavier weights and rough terrain.Users with bigger body frames or those needing additional power for irregular ground.Key Features to Consider

It's also smart to examine if a license is needed in their location.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Do I require a driving license to use a mobility scooter in the UK?
No, you do not require a driving license to utilize a Class 2 mobility scooter. However, Class 3 scooters must be registered with the DVLA, and the user must understand traffic regulations.
2. How fast can mobility scooters go?
Class 2 scooters have an optimal speed of 4mph, while Class 3 scooters can increase to 8mph. Always check regional policies as these speeds might be limited in specific locations.
3. Can I take my mobility scooter on public transportation?
Numerous public transport services enable mobility scooters, however users need to examine with specific transportation business for size constraints and guidelines.
4. What is the average cost of a mobility scooter?
Rates for mobility scooters can vary considerably based on the design and functions. Basic models may start at around ₤ 500, while high-end or heavy-duty designs can surpass ₤ 3,000.
5. For how long does the battery last?
Battery life differs by model and use, but a totally charged battery can normally last anywhere from 10 to 30 miles usually.
